Game Story
Houston holds off East Carolina 31-24
Houston defeated East Carolina 31-24 in Week 8 of the 2021 regular slate, finishing with a 256-360 edge in total yards, and scoring 2 passing touchdowns and 1 rushing touchdowns.
Houston set the terms early in a game that finished 31-24. Dalton Witherspoon 21 yd FG GOOD came with {'seconds': 56, 'minutes': 6} left in the first quarter, giving Houston the first major swing.
Houston's box score carried the story: 256 total yards, 87 rushing yards, and 169 passing yards. East Carolina finished with 360 total yards, including 82 on the ground and 278 through the air.
Houston converted 3-13 on third down, went 0-0 on fourth down, the turnover count was 1-3, Houston led 24-10 at halftime. The explosive highlight was Alton McCaskill run for 25 yds for a TD (Dalton Witherspoon KICK).

Analysis
Game Breakdown
| Statistic | Houston | East Carolina |
|---|---|---|
| Total Yards | 256 | 360 |
| Passing Yards | 169 | 278 |
| Rushing Yards | 87 | 82 |
| First Downs | 16 | 20 |
| Third Down Efficiency | 3-13 | 1-12 |
| Fourth Down Efficiency | 0-0 | 0-3 |
| Total Penalties (Yards) | 10-80 | 7-60 |
| Turnovers | 1 | 3 |
| Completions / Attempts | 19-29 | 23-37 |
| Rushing Attempts | 36 | 35 |
| Passing TDs | 2 | 2 |
| Rushing TDs | 1 | 1 |
| Kicking Points | 7 | 6 |
| Possession Time | 30:47 | 29:13 |
